> When x-vendor-cpuid-only is enabled, QEMU suppresses CPUID leaves 2
> and 4 for AuthenticAMD CPUs because those leaves describe Intel cache
> information. Hygon Dhyana uses the HygonGenuine vendor string, so it
> currently skips that filtering and can expose Intel cache leaves together
> with AMD/Hygon extended cache leaves.
>
> That is inconsistent guest-visible CPUID: Hygon Dhyana provides cache
> information through the extended cache leaves, so it should not also
> advertise the Intel cache descriptor and deterministic cache parameter
> leaves.
>
> Apply the same leaf 2 and leaf 4 filtering to Hygon CPUs when Hygon
> vendor ABI fixes are enabled. The property keeps the old CPUID output
> for pc-11.0 and older machine types.
